On this day in the United States
- 1785 – The dollar is chosen as the monetary unit for the United States.
- 1887 – David Kalakaua (pictured), monarch of the Kingdom of Hawaii, is forced at gunpoint to sign the 1887 Constitution of the Kingdom of Hawaii, which supposedly set up a constitutional monarchy but in reality transferred most power to American and European elites.
- 1892 – 3,800 striking steelworkers engage in a day-long battle with Pinkerton agents during the Homestead Strike, leaving 10 dead and dozens wounded.
- 1933 – The first Major League Baseball All-Star Game is played in Chicago's Comiskey Park. The American League defeats the National League, 4 to 2.
- 1986 – Davis Phinney became the first American cyclist to win a road stage of the Tour de France.
